@pytest.hookimpl(tryfirst=True, hookwrapper=True)
def pytest_runtest_makereport(item, call):
"""Stash the status of each item."""
"""Stash the status of each item and turn unexpected skips into errors."""
outcome = yield
rep = outcome.get_result()
rep: pytest.TestReport = outcome.get_result()
item.stash.setdefault(_phase_report_key, {})[rep.when] = rep
_modify_report_skips(rep)
return rep


@pytest.hookimpl(tryfirst=True, hookwrapper=True)
def pytest_make_collect_report(collector: pytest.Collector):
"""Turn unexpected skips during collection (e.g., module-level) into errors."""
outcome = yield
rep: pytest.CollectReport = outcome.get_result()
_modify_report_skips(rep)
return rep


# Default means "allow all skips". Can use something like "$." to mean
# "never match", i.e., "treat all skips as errors"
_valid_skips_re = re.compile(os.getenv("MNE_TEST_ALLOW_SKIP", ".*"))


# To turn unexpected skips into errors, we need to look both at the collection phase
# (for decorated tests) and the call phase (for things like `importorskip`
# within the test body). code adapted from pytest-error-for-skips
def _modify_report_skips(report: pytest.TestReport | pytest.CollectReport):
if not report.skipped:
return
if isinstance(report.longrepr, tuple):
file, lineno, reason = report.longrepr
else:
file, lineno, reason = "<unknown>", 1, str(report.longrepr)
if _valid_skips_re.match(reason):
return
assert isinstance(report, pytest.TestReport | pytest.CollectReport), type(report)
if file.endswith("doctest.py"): # _python/doctest.py
return
# xfail tests aren't true "skips" but show up as skipped in reports
if getattr(report, "keywords", {}).get("xfail", False):
return
# the above only catches marks, so we need to actually parse the report to catch
# an xfail based on the traceback
if " pytest.xfail( " in reason:
return
if reason.startswith("Skipped: "):
reason = reason[9:]
report.longrepr = f"{file}:{lineno}: UNEXPECTED SKIP: {reason}"
# Make it show up as an error in the report
report.outcome = "error" if isinstance(report, pytest.TestReport) else "failed"
